Critical Roof Inspection Tips to Address Water Intrusion
Proper inspections are vital in averting potential catastrophes arising from water intrusion. Here, we'll outline several importance-driven steps that every business owner should follow to bolster their roofing defenses.
- Step 1: Perform Regular Visual Inspections - Recognize the importance of routinely checking your roof for any visible signs of wear. Look for damaged flashing, cracked seams, or pooled water. These issues can develop into costly repairs if left unchecked, as noted by industry statistics which show that minor leaks can escalate into significant structural failures (NRCA.net).
- Step 2: Inspect Drains and Gutters - Ensure that all drains, gutters, and downspouts are clear of debris. Clogged drainage systems are often the primary culprits behind leaks and water pooling. According to experts, neglecting drainage maintenance can lead to expensive remediation costs down the line (EPA.gov).
- Step 3: Schedule Professional Roof Assessments - While DIY inspections are beneficial, professional evaluations by certified roofing contractors are vital. These experts can identify hidden issues that untrained eyes may miss, saving you from substantial damage later.
- Step 4: Monitor Surrounding Area Vegetation - Trees and plants surrounding your commercial facility can impact your roof as well. Roots can penetrate roofing materials, leading to significant issues. Regularly trim or remove trees that pose a threat to your roofing structure.
- Step 5: Document Findings and Work Orders - Maintain comprehensive records of inspections and repairs. By documenting every issue and maintenance activity, you can create a timeline for future reference and have a clearer understanding of your roof's condition over time.
Avoiding Common Pitfalls in Roof Maintenance
Timely roof maintenance is crucial to preventing severe water intrusion issues. Failure to address common mistakes can lead to unnecessary complications and expenses. Below are some frequent pitfalls seen in commercial roofing that you should consciously avoid.
- Ignoring Minor Damage: Small cracks and leaks can often be overlooked. However, if left unattended, these minor inconveniences can evolve into major issues that could require complete roof replacement.
- Delaying Repairs: Procrastination can be costly when it comes to roof maintenance. Addressing issues promptly is essential, as every moment you wait heightens the risk of extensive damage.
- Overlooking Seasonal Changes: Failing to inspect your roof after seasonal changes, particularly in winter or heavy rain seasons, can leave your building vulnerable to unexpected leaks.
- Not Following Manufacturer Guidelines: Many manufacturers provide specific care instructions for their materials. Neglecting these guidelines can void warranties and lead to considerable headaches.
- Inadequate Budgeting for Maintenance: Underestimating maintenance costs can leave your roof vulnerable. Allocate sufficient funds to address inspection and repair needs effectively.

5 Essential Tips for Effective Commercial Roof Maintenance
Maintaining a commercial roof is crucial to its longevity and operational efficiency. Here are five proven tips to ensure your roof remains in pristine condition.
Tip 1: Conduct Seasonal Inspections - Schedule comprehensive inspections at the beginning of each season to identify any potential problems caused by environmental factors, ensuring immediate remediation leads to longer-lasting sustainability. Tip 2: Use Quality Materials for Repairs - When conducting repairs, always utilize high-quality materials that meet or exceed local building codes. This strategy alleviates the risk of recurrent issues due to inferior materials. Tip 3: Ensure Adequate Insulation and Ventilation - Proper insulation and ventilation can significantly affect your roof's life span. A well-ventilated roof minimizes moisture accumulation, which substantially reduces the risk of leaks and water intrusion. Tip 4: Work with Experienced Contractors - Engaging with seasoned roofing professionals means you can capitalize on their knowledge of typical issues and optimal fixes, preventing future concerns that could arise from untrained hands. Tip 5: Invest in Preventative Measures - Adopting a proactive maintenance schedule rather than a reactive one is key.
